Hyundai Santa FE engine produces 13 HP more power than Chevrolet Captiva, whereas torque is 22 NM more than Chevrolet Captiva. Thanks to more power Hyundai Santa FE reaches 100 km/h speed 0.1 seconds faster.

The Hyundai Santa FE is a better choice when it comes to fuel economy.
By specification Hyundai Santa FE consumes 0.3 litres less fuel per 100 km than the Chevrolet Captiva, which means that by driving the Hyundai Santa FE over 15,000 km in a year you can save 45 litres of fuel.
By comparing actual fuel consumption based on user reports, Hyundai Santa FE consumes 1.3 litres less fuel per 100 km than the Chevrolet Captiva.

Engine spread: Installed on at least 3 other car models, including Kia Sorento, Kia Carnival, Hyundai GrandeurUsed also on Opel Antara
In general, the longer and for more car models an engine is produced, the better its serviceability and availability of spare parts. Hyundai Santa FE might be a better choice in this respect.

Hyundai Santa FE has more luggage capacity.
Even though the car is shorter, Hyundai Santa FE has 51 litres more trunk space than the Chevrolet Captiva. The Chevrolet Captiva may have more interior space, so the cabin could be more spacious and more comfortable for the driver and passengers.
Turning diameter: 10.9 meters11.8 meters
The turning circle of the Hyundai Santa FE is 0.9 metres less than that of the Chevrolet Captiva, which means Hyundai Santa FE can be easier to manoeuvre in tight streets and parking spaces.

Safety:
Hyundai Santa FE scores higher in safety tests, but Chevrolet Captiva is better rated in child safety tests. The Hyundai Santa FE scores higher in active safety technologies (stability control, lane assist, automatic braking, etc.) tests.
